Output 8682186276957d068cfb5d1d0feca65a67e20b317fdab0814ee743538f3afa61:5

value
28397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f85539e637e412d0300942025f617fad3b676b OP_EQUAL
address
3DdXFxMFyB2af2YBzQKycGeqV5ATbukVqi
transaction
8682186276957d068cfb5d1d0feca65a67e20b317fdab0814ee743538f3afa61
spent
true